Yes, it's possible to configure ntop for you to keep historical reports. Check out the "RRD" plug-in support. You can configure it on the plug-in page for various time frames. The types of traffic that are kept on a per-host basis depend upon what you have told NTop to capture. Burton wrote a nice paper on this, it's available on: http://lists.ntop.org/pipermail/ntop/2003-July/006098.html or http://www.mirrors.wiretapped.net/security/network-monitoring/ntop/rrdan dntop.pdf 2. Use the -p flag (I recommend you configure ntop.conf to point to a file rather than specify the ports on the command line - see the man page for details.)
